✦ Synopsis


Abstract

A consecutive single‐route reaction is considered. When two (groups of) steps compete in controlling the overall reaction rate, there exists a general rule that the earlier step in the flow of the overall reaction tends to be rate‐determining with the increase of the reaction affinity. The latter may, however, be distributed more or less evenly to both steps.
